Well, work interfeared with what I enjoy----again!!!!


I have accomplished quit a lot on the 442. Got the intake gaskets changed, vacuum operated heat control valve, replaced the POS Holley with a Edelbrock, Got most of the right front ready to take apart so I have a straight fender. Will work on the heater core when I have plenty of time. I'm going to see if I can make an access door to that. Thankfully it's been routine stuff---so far. I'll be changing the rear gear from the current 3:91 to a much more useable 3:36.


I got most of the body parts from The Parts Place in IL. They had everything in stock so I drove down and picked 'em up. I must say, I'm very impressed with the quality of the fender. Definitely GM specs. It weighs more than the bumper----lol Shannon was helpful and friendly.
